Publication number: 20220220716Abstract: A water outlet box of a pressure-type flushing system and a toilet using the water outlet box, including a water outlet box main body and a first one-way valve assembly. The water outlet box main body is formed with a water-passing cavity, a water inlet, at least one water outlet and a vent, with the water inlet, the water outlet and the vent all connecting with the water-passing cavity. The first one-way valve assembly is provided opposite to the water inlet to open or block the water inlet, and when the pressure-type flushing system finishes flushing, the first one-way valve assembly blocks the water inlet. The vent is provided at the top of the water-passing cavity and is open to the atmosphere. The water outlet box main body is provided with several water inlet pipes in communication with the functional devices of the pressure-type flushing system.Type: ApplicationFiled: September 20, 2019Publication date: July 14, 2022Inventors: Xiping LI, Jun HUANG, Bingxing HUANG, Dongsheng ZHANG, Jianfu WU, Jinding DAI

Publication number: 20220197391Abstract: A haptic feedback device includes: a first feedback apparatus, including: a fixed platform, a movable platform, a ring disposed on the movable platform, and a power unit disposed on the fixed platform and connected to the movable platform. The power unit is configured to obtain a first control signal generated by a controller and output torsion according to the first control signal. The movable platform is configured to be driven by the torsion to move relative to the fixed platform. The ring is configured to provide feedback force as the movable platform moves, to implement haptic feedback.Type: ApplicationFiled: March 14, 2022Publication date: June 23, 2022Inventors: Dongsheng ZHANG, Lei WEI, Ke CHEN, Qiang LI

Patent number: 11315750Abstract: An anode target comprises: a plurality of target structures, used for receiving an electron beam emitted by a cathode to generate a ray, the plurality of target structures being of three-dimensional structures having bevels; a copper cooling body, used for bearing the target structures and comprising an oxygen-free copper cooling body; a cooling oil tube, used for cooling the anode target; and a shielding layer, used for achieving a shielding effect and comprising a tungsten shielding layer. The anode target, the ray light source, the computed tomography scanning device, and the imaging method in the present application are able to enable all target spots on the anode target to be distributed on a straight line, imaging quality of a ray system is improved, and complexity of an imaging system is reduced.Type: GrantFiled: June 1, 2018Date of Patent: April 26, 2022Assignees: Nuctech Company Limited, TSINGHUA UNIVERSITYInventors: Chengjun Tan, Wenhui Huang, Chuanxiang Tang, Qingxiu Jin, Dongsheng Zhang, Qun Luo, Donghai Liu, Luming Zhang, Peidong Wu

Patent number: 11201030Abstract: A distributed X-ray light source comprises: a plurality of arranged cathode assemblies used for emitting electron beams; an anode target used for receiving the electron beams emitted by the cathode assemblies; and compensation electrodes and focusing electrodes provided in sequence between the plurality of the cathode assemblies and the anode target, the compensation electrode being used for adjusting electric field strength at two ends of a grid structure in each cathode assembly, and the focusing electrode being used for focusing the electron beams emitted by the cathode assemblies, wherein the focusing electrode corresponding to at least one cathode assembly in the plurality of the cathode assemblies comprises a first electrode and a second electrode which are separately provided, and an electron beam channel is formed between the first electrode and the second electrode.Type: GrantFiled: May 29, 2018Date of Patent: December 14, 2021Assignees: Nuctech Company Limited, TSINGHUA UNIVERSITYInventors: Chengjun Tan, Wenhui Huang, Chuanxiang Tang, Qingxiu Jin, Dongsheng Zhang, Qun Luo, Donghai Liu, Luming Zhang, Peidong Wu

Publication number: 20200168428Abstract: An anode target, a ray light source, a computed tomography device, and an imaging method, which relate to the technical field of ray processing. The anode target comprises a first anode target, a second anode target, and a ceramic plate. The first anode target is used for enabling, by means of a first voltage carried on the first anode target, an electron beam emitted by a cathode to generate a first ray on a target spot of the first anode target. The second anode target is used for enabling, by means of a second voltage carried on the second anode target, an electron beam emitted by the cathode to generate a second tray on a target spot of the second anode. The ceramic plate is used for isolating the first anode target from the second anode target. By means of the anode target, the ray light source, the computed tomography device and the imaging method, dual-energy distributed ray imaging data can be provided and the imaging quality of a ray system can be improved.Type: ApplicationFiled: September 13, 2018Publication date: May 28, 2020Applicants: Nuctech Company Limited, TSINGHUA UNIVERSITYInventors: Chengjun TAN, Wenhui HUANG, Chuanxiang TANG, Qingxiu JIN, Dongsheng ZHANG, Qun LUO, Donghai LIU, Luming ZHANG, Peidong WU

Patent number: 10629402Abstract: A cathode assembly, an X-ray source and a CT device are provided. The cathode assembly includes a ceramic plug having a first and second end portions. Four wiring terminals and a protruding positioning part are provided on the first end portion. An internal cavity is formed in the ceramic plug, and a cathode is provided therein. The cathode has a filament with a positive and negative electrode leads. A grid is provided on the second end portion and has a grid voltage signal line. The cathode has a cathode surface lead. The positive electrode lead, the negative electrode lead, the grid voltage signal line and the cathode surface lead are electrically connected to one of the wiring terminals, respectively. The ceramic socket has four wiring tubes which may be electrically connected with the four wiring terminals.Type: GrantFiled: December 28, 2017Date of Patent: April 21, 2020Assignees: TSINGHUA UNIVERSITY, NUCTECH COMPANY LIMITEDInventors: Wenhui Huang, Dongsheng Zhang, Qingxiu Jin, Chengjun Tan, Donghai Liu, Qun Luo, Chuanxiang Tang

Patent number: 9571116Abstract: An adaptive filtering digital calibration circuit of ADC, which includes a control module, a fixed-point adder, and a fixed-point multiplier; the control module includes a finite-state machine, a shift register, and a register array; the fixed-point adder allows an addend and an augend to be added together after being encoded; the control module controls to complete all the calibration algorithmic operation, which includes the following steps: the control module controls to obtain an original binary value from an external ADC; calculating an error value according to weight and disturbance signals, and carrying out the weight updating operation and the disturbance signal updating operation according to the error value; carrying out the gain calibration operation; and carrying out the final result operation. The present invention also discloses a method of the adaptive filtering digital calibration of ADC.Type: GrantFiled: December 30, 2015Date of Patent: February 14, 2017Assignee: Shanghai Huahong Grace Semiconductor Manufacturing CorporationInventor: Dongsheng Zhang
